On the 6th of June, Rene Rozendal from Icecat is hosting an informational event for players in the toy industry. This event, which is being held for the second time, is centered around knowledge, inspiration, and networking. Additionally, exchange of knowledge between participants is encouraged, and the event will be closed with networking drinks.
Although the program of the event is still under work, key speakers Alain Hellebaut (CEO, Maxi Toys), Ted Arends (Manager Content Center of Excellence, Wehkamp), Joris Kroese (CEO, Hatch) and John Meulemans (Managing Director, 3Sixtyfive) have confirmed. The finalized event program will be made available soon on the event page.
